Allium flower blooms in The Cotswolds, Gloucestershire, England


Size: 5760px × 3840px
Location: The Cotswolds, Gloucestershire, England
Photo credit: © Ian Henley /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: alive, allium, beautiful, bloom, blooms, britain, british, colourful, colours, cotswolds, cottage, creation, england, english, flower, flowers, garden, gardening, gods, handiwork, handwork, happiness, happy, head, joy, joyful, lovely, onion, ornamental, peace, plant, spikes, success, summer, summertime, tranquil, tranquility